> Wasn't 2.4.15 the "DON'T USE THIS!" kernel that damaged filesystems?

After checking kernel.org: Yes, it was! You really, really shouldn't
use it. If you ever used it at all, there's a very good chance your
filesystems were already in trouble before you ever tried converting
to ext3.
